Vigo County Sheriff's Office, Indiana
End of Watch Wednesday, July 1, 1987
Add to My HeroesWalter Kevin Artz
Sergeant Walter Artz was shot and killed after responding to a domestic disturbance.
As officers attempted to calm the man down at the back door of the home the man suddenly began firing, fatally wounding Sergeant Artz. Officers returned fire and wounded the man, who then committed suicide.
Sergeant Artz had served with the Vigo County Sheriff's Department for 11 years. He was survived by his wife and two daughters.
